Key Responsibilities
- Manage new equipment start up, liaise with vendors, to acceptance of equipment for production
- Plan, organize and implement technical support and expertise on specific tools to Assistant Maintenance Engineers and Technicians
- Establish CM procedures and troubleshooting guides to allow efficient troubleshooting
- Establish PM procedures to achieve best possible Preventive Maintenance efficiency without compromising quality
- Provide training to Assistant Maintenance Engineers, Technicians to enhance their troubleshooting skills and equipment knowledge
- Establish critical equipment spares, consumables stock levels to support equipment recovery time
- Translates the requirements of Production and Engineering needs into maintenance tasks and work closely with them to achieve the overall committed targets in all aspects of manufacturing parameters
- Participate in cost reduction projects to maintain cost efficiency
- Generate regular Equipment downtime pareto reports and analyzing for any chronic/repeated issues
